Changed defaults in Splitfork, our assignment service. Bucketing now uses sticky hashing per account instead of per session, and the holdout slice grew from 2% to 5%. Callers relying on session-level reassignment must opt in explicitly. Review the diff against the new baseline; the updated default configuration is listed below.

config for tagep-kajof:
[casir]
port = 6379
region = south-1
host = casir.paliqdyn.example
team = tamax
timeout_ms = 250
retries = 2

**Break-glass: Legacy ORM refactor safeguards**

Reviewers: the ongoing refactor of the Cobblestitch ORM layer replaces hand-rolled query builders with the new Lanternmap adapter. Both paths run in parallel behind a flag, with row-level diffs logged nightly. If the adapter corrupts a write and the flag service is unreachable, break-glass access lets you flip the kill switch directly on the database proxy. Approve no merges that remove the dual-write path until migration completes. The break-glass console accepts the passphrase shown below.

unlock words, fadug-yagug: fraael-pramir-ulaax-zorys-gorvan-brieth

Quick note on the Fernwhistle token bug: sessions were refreshing twice when the clock skewed, logging users out mid-checkout. The fix ships in 4.2.1, already tagged. When you cut the release, the hotfix branch needs re-signing since we rotated credentials last sprint. Here's the signing key you'll need.

rollout seal: bky4_DFM9

# Contrast Audit Vars — Lumoset Support Wiki

The Tintcheck audit job scans every Lumoset screen for WCAG contrast failures. Support can trigger a re-scan with `tintcheck run --all`. Set AUDIT_REGION and AUDIT_SEVERITY before running. The scanner also needs authenticated access to the design token service, so add its token on the following line.

sealed setting: ARCHIVE_KEY3=8d0

Leadership Review Briefing — Branch Managers

The Quillspar line is underpriced against Dornick's comparable range by 8–11%. Margins are thinnest on mid-tier bundles. Proposal: a staged 6% uplift over two quarters, holding entry SKUs flat. Branch feedback due Wednesday. Full model in the leadership pack. One point is for this audience only.

internal memo for kaduf-baduf: Only 35 of the 378 pilot accounts renewed Holir, so a churn review is set for June 11. Eliielax Group is in early talks to buy Silaelix Group for about $142.1 million.